Murray Falls to Holy Cross in All 'A' Title Game

Ally Mayhaus' layup with :09 left proved to be the game-winning shot as Covington Holy Cross beat Murray 47-46 in the girls’ Touchstone Energy All “A” Classic finals Sunday afternoon in the Frankfort Convention Center.

Murray trailed 39-30 late in the third quarter but rallied to take a 46-43 lead on two Elizabeth Grogan free throws with :23 left. Instead of allowing the Lady Indians a chance to tie the game with a three-pointer, the Lady Tigers decided to foul Deja Turner, who hit both free throws, cutting the lead to one with :12 left.

Murray turned the ball over on the in-bounds play, setting up the game-winning play by Mayhaus. The Lady Tigers had one final chance to win the game, but Alexis Burpo's 15-footer fell short.

Turner led Holy Cross with 14 points. Mayhaus finished with nine points, 11 rebounds and six blocked shots. Dajah McClendon had nine points and eight assists.

Maddie Waldrop led Murray with 18 points and 15 rebounds. Grogran had 14 points. Macey Turley added 12 points and four assists.
